Explanation:
Access to a fire hydrant must be unobstructed so firefighters can quickly reach, connect hoses, and operate the hydrant. That means there is a minimum clearance around the hydrant that parked vehicles must respect. If a car sits too close, it blocks access and can lead to fines or towing.
